Hello, everyone!Â
I get a lot of asks asking me where certain old VODs are, and while I donât mind these asks at all, I also figured it would be helpful to make a guide post on my methods for locating them so that people can attempt to locate things for themselves too!
There are plenty of ways to go about it, but this is just what I do.
Without further ado, hereâs a step-by-step process.Â
â
Before you go searching for anything, thereâs some information that youâll need to decide on.
What are you looking for?
This oneâs a bit obvious, but you need to figure out what exactly youâll be seeking out. For this guide, Iâll be using the first Dreamon Hunters VOD as an example, as thatâs one that people have asked for a lot in the past.
When did it happen?
As a general question, youâll want to know the basic context of around what time this event took place. Weâll get into specifics later, but it helps to have context. Think: what else was happening at the time?
Well, for Dreamon Hunters, we know that Fundy was wearing his Dreamon Hunters outfit at the Manberg Festival, October 16. Therefore, that event took place not too long before then.
From whose POV?
Youâll need to know which streamers to search under. The first Dreamon Hunters stream was streamed by Fundy and Tubbo.Â
Tubboâs official VODs channel does not include the first Dreamon Hunters VOD, and the oldest VOD on Archive is Festival preparation on October 13. Unfortunately, this means that Tubboâs POV is lost, so we will be seeking out Fundyâs.
â
Now that weâve got that out of the way, onto the next steps.
There are a few ways to achieve this. If youâre lucky, youâll know the date already â November 16th, January 6th, other big ones like that. Sometimes you can look at recap posts if they exist for that day.Â
But the most reliable one Iâve found, especially for Season One, is actually to use Twitterâs advanced search.
(Yeah, yeah, I know what youâre thinking. But it genuinely works pretty well)
Type in keywords that you think would end up in livetweets of the stream. If something specific was trending that day because of the event, that helps as well. For this example, weâll use âDreamXD,â as that was trending.
Scroll down to the bottom and select a date range. This is where knowing the general time that the event happened helps. Weâll do October 1 - October 16.
There! Weâve found the livetweets! How nostalgic.Â
Figure out the earliest date.Â
For our example, it appears to be October 7. Note that VOD dates might be a day later due to different timezones.
You donât necessarily need this step, but it can often be helpful when scrolling through a large selection of VODs, and since sometimes the VOD dates can be a day off, having the title will give you the most accuracy.
Go to Twitchtracker.com/ [insert streamer name] /streams and click on the date you just found.
From here, we can see that Fundyâs stream on October 7 was titled âTHE NEW MANBERG.â
I will be linking a bunch of unofficial VODs channels that Iâd recommend at the end. Here we will be using Fundy Stream Archive.
And there we go! We have successfully located the first Dreamon Hunters VOD!
â
Now, that was an easy example. Things can get a bit more difficult than that.
For our next example: what if you wanted to find the original Captain Puffy âduckling Dreamâ VOD?Â
When did it happen?
If you remember, this stream happened when Captain Puffy hadnât yet chosen her alliances between Dream SMP and Lâmanburg. Therefore, it would have been November or early December, soon after she joined the server.
Using the Twitter search method, weâll search for âduckling Dreamâ in the date range November 16 - December 20.
The earliest date appears to be November 29.
Using Twitchtracker, we know that Captain Puffyâs stream on November 29 was titled âNightime vibing on the Dream SMP!â
Next, since Captain Puffyâs VODs from this early on havenât been archived to a channel on YouTube, weâll visit Archive.org instead. Search up âCaptain PuffyâÂ
Be sure to sort by date. This will display the date below, but Iâd still recommend you have the stream title on hand as well.
Aaaand
There you have it! A step-by-step guide on how to locate old VODs yourselves!
â
Unfortunately, there is content that canât be found this way.
Tubboâs August and September VODs, Eret and Jack Manifoldâs August VODs, a couple Tommy streams, HBombâs Doomsday stream, etc., are all missing.
